The Neurosurgery Surgical 8¼″ Overholt Dissecting Forceps Type E, Long Curve is a specialized microsurgical instrument developed to support precise dissection, vessel isolation, and tissue handling in demanding neurosurgical and vascular procedures. Featuring a long curved working profile and an ergonomic design, this instrument provides surgeons with enhanced access to deep and confined anatomical spaces while maintaining excellent control and tactile feedback.
Designed for advanced surgical applications, the Overholt Dissecting Forceps Type E Long Curve is commonly used in neurosurgery, spinal surgery, vascular surgery, cranial procedures, and other microsurgical disciplines where precision and delicate tissue handling are essential. The extended curved configuration allows surgeons to navigate around nerves, blood vessels, and other critical structures while reducing unnecessary tissue manipulation.
The long curved jaws are engineered to improve access to difficult-to-reach surgical sites. This design allows the surgeon to approach tissues from an optimal angle, making it highly effective for vessel preparation, blunt dissection, and controlled tissue separation. The curved profile enhances visualization by keeping the surgeon’s hand and instrument shaft away from the direct line of sight, which is especially beneficial during microscope-assisted procedures.
The 8¼-inch length provides an ideal balance between reach and maneuverability. The extended shaft enables access to deeper operative fields while maintaining precise control over the instrument tip. This makes the forceps particularly valuable in complex neurosurgical procedures involving deep cranial structures, spinal anatomy, and vascular areas where accurate instrument placement is required.
